Common Reasons for Fat Accumulation
Fat can build up in the body for many reasons. Sometimes, it is due to genetics. Other times, lifestyle choices play a role. For example, eating high-calorie foods or not moving enough can cause weight gain. Hormones and age also affect how your body stores fat. In some cases, stress or certain medicines may lead to fat buildup. Even after diet and exercise, some fat may not go away. Therefore, many people look for advanced fat reduction options.

How to Choose the Right Technique
Choosing the best fat reduction method depends on your needs. First, think about your health and goals. Next, consider how much fat you want to remove. Some people want quick results, while others prefer less downtime. Your doctor will check your body and suggest the best option. For example, if you want no surgery, non-surgical methods may suit you. However, for larger fat areas, liposuction might work better. Always ask about the risks and recovery time before you decide.
